Transaction 68f91dae23f0d312f9f436d91c6dfd904f7fc5a838813781cd63709211c0018f

1 Input
2 Outputs
  • 68f91dae23f0d312f9f436d91c6dfd904f7fc5a838813781cd63709211c0018f:0
  • value  5108026
    address  1EfDcEkRt6PoUia8AFSEc9CGQdWW62w7FJ
  • 68f91dae23f0d312f9f436d91c6dfd904f7fc5a838813781cd63709211c0018f:1
  • value  55342620
    address  1M2FBqjszkLp2Fo6LckMURCWEUK27tP1P7